Katalog domowy Linuksa jest katalogiem konkretnego użytkownika systemu i składa się z pojedynczych plików. Nazywa się go także tzw katalog logowania . Jest to pierwsze miejsce, które następuje po zalogowaniu się do systemu Linux. Jest tworzony automatycznie jako '/dom' dla każdego użytkownika w katalogu”. Jest to standardowy podkatalog katalogu głównego. Katalog główny zawiera wszystkie pozostałe katalogi, podkatalogi i pliki w systemie. Jest on oznaczony ukośnikiem (/).
Katalog domowy można określić jako osobistą przestrzeń roboczą dla wszystkich użytkowników oprócz roota. Dla każdego użytkownika istnieje oddzielny katalog. Na przykład dwóch użytkowników „jtp1” i „jtp2” będzie miało katalogi takie jak „/home/jtp1” i „/home/jtp2”. Ci użytkownicy będą mieli wszystkie prawa do plików w swoich katalogach.
Użytkownik root (administracyjny) jest jedynym użytkownikiem, którego katalog domowy domyślnie znajduje się w innej lokalizacji. Ścieżka użytkownika root to „/root/”, gdzie ma on kontrolę nad wszystkimi katalogami i plikami.
Jak znaleźć katalog domowy?
Dostęp do katalogu domowego i powrót do niego można uzyskać na wiele sposobów. Niektóre polecenia są bardzo pomocne w przypadku katalogów, np płyta CD , pw , mkdir , pw , ls i rmdir. Aby uzyskać graficzny dostęp do katalogu domowego, otwórz plik akta aplikacji i kliknij przycisk Dom opcję z menu po lewej stronie. Rozważ poniższy obraz:
Tutaj możemy przeglądać nasz katalog domowy.
Ogólnie rzecz biorąc, nasz terminal otwiera się z konkretnym katalogiem użytkownika. Aby zmienić katalog na katalog domowy, wykonaj polecenie polecenie płyty następująco:
cd /home
Powyższe polecenie zmieni katalog na home. Aby wyświetlić katalog domowy, wykonaj polecenie ls w następujący sposób:
ls
Rozważ poniższe dane wyjściowe:
Możemy wrócić do naszego katalogu domowego, wykonując polecenie cd bez żadnych argumentów. Powróci do naszego katalogu domowego z dowolnego katalogu, nad którym pracujemy. Wykonaj to w następujący sposób:
cd
Rozważ poniższe dane wyjściowe:
Z powyższych danych wynika, że byliśmy w /Directory/files, wykonując tylko polecenie cd, dotarliśmy do naszego katalogu domowego. Aby zrobić to samo, możemy również użyć poleceń „cd ~ lub cd $HOME”. Rozważ poniższe polecenia:
cd ~ cd $Home
Aby wyświetlić bieżący katalog roboczy, wykonaj polecenie pwd w następujący sposób:
pwd
Rozważ poniższe dane wyjściowe:
Aby utworzyć katalog w katalogu, wykonaj polecenie polecenie mkdir następująco:
mkdir
Rozważ poniższe dane wyjściowe:
Na podstawie powyższych wyników utworzyliśmy katalog jako „nowy_katalog” i wyświetliliśmy go, wykonując polecenie ls.
Możemy również usunąć katalog. Aby usunąć katalog, wykonaj polecenie rmdir w następujący sposób:
rmdir
Rozważ poniższe dane wyjściowe:
Z powyższych wyników usunęliśmy katalog „nowy_katalog”.
Różnica między katalogiem głównym a katalogiem domowym
Oto niektóre kluczowe różnice między katalogiem głównym a katalogiem domowym:
Katalog główny | Katalog domowy |
---|---|
Katalog główny to najwyższy poziom dysku systemowego. | Katalog domowy jest podkatalogiem katalogu głównego. |
Jest to oznaczone ukośnikiem „/”. | Jest oznaczony przez „~” i ma ścieżkę „ /użytkownicy/nazwa użytkownika '. |
Administrator ma możliwość wprowadzania wszelkich zmian w plikach i ustawieniach. | Żaden użytkownik inny niż użytkownik root nie może zmieniać ustawień całego systemu. |
Administrator może utworzyć użytkownika. | Żaden użytkownik posiadający katalog domowy nie może utworzyć użytkownika. |
W systemie plików Linux wszystko znajduje się w katalogu głównym. | Katalog domowy zawiera dane konkretnego użytkownika. |